免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

ios的app是用java开发的吗

iOS的应用程序是使用Objective-C或Swift编程语言来开发的,而不是Java。 Java是一种用于开发Android应用程序的编程语言,而Objective-C和Swift是苹果公司为iOS和macOS操作系统开发的专门语言。

Objective-C是一种面向对象的编程语言,它是C语言的扩展。它于1980年代初由Brad Cox和Tom Love开发,而后被NeXT公司采用并成为了苹果公司开发iOS应用程序的首选语言。

Swift是苹果公司于2014年推出的一种全新的开发语言,旨在提供更高效、更安全、更易读的编程体验。Swift结合了Objective-C和Cocoa框架的强大功能,并添加了很多现代化的特性,使得开发人员能够更快速地开发出高质量的应用程序。

iOS应用程序的开发工作主要是在Xcode集成开发环境中进行的。开发者可以使用Xcode中的各种工具和功能,通过Objective-C或Swift编写代码,创建用户界面、处理数据、实现功能等。

在应用程序设计过程中,开发者会使用iOS SDK(软件开发工具包),其中包含了各种用于开发iOS应用程序的库和工具。这些库和工具提供了许多函数和类,用于处理iOS设备的各种功能,如触摸屏、摄像头、位置信息等。开发者可以利用这些功能来创建交互式和功能丰富的应用程序。

在开发过程中,开发者通常会使用图形界面工具来设计应用程序的用户界面,然后使用代码来实现界面上的交互和功能。开发者还可以使用调试工具来检查代码的运行情况,以及性能分析工具来优化应用程序的性能。

一旦开发完成,开发者可以使用Xcode将应用程序打包为一个iOS可执行文件,然后通过App Store或企业部署等方式分发和发布应用程序。

总之,iOS应用程序是使用Objective-C或Swift编程语言开发的,开发者利用Xcode和iOS SDK来创建功能丰富的应用程序,并通过打包和分发方式将应用程序发布给用户使用。


相关知识:
浅析餐饮预订app开发前景
餐饮预订app是一款能够方便用户在线预订餐厅、点餐、支付等一系列服务的应用程序。近年来,随着移动互联网的发展,餐饮预订app的市场需求不断增加,成为一种新的消费方式。本文将从餐饮预订app的市场前景、开发原理以及优劣势分析三个方面进行阐述。一、市场前景随着
2024-01-10
如何在iphone上安装自己开发的app
在iPhone上安装自己开发的应用程序有两种方法:通过Xcode进行部署或通过企业级分发。1. 通过Xcode进行部署要在iPhone上安装自己开发的应用程序,第一步是要有一个开发者账户。在Apple开发者网站上注册账户后,可以使用Xcode进行应用程序的
2024-01-10
hybird app混合开发技术方案
混合开发是一种结合了Web技术和原生App开发技术的开发模式,旨在通过使用Web技术开发App的UI和业务逻辑,然后通过原生桥接的方式在移动设备上运行,从而实现跨平台开发的效果。混合开发可以在同时享受Web开发的便利性和原生开发的性能,是一种高效快速的开发
2023-07-14
app制作开发方法包括
APP(Application)制作开发即移动应用程序的开发,是指将软件应用程序开发成适用于移动设备(如智能手机、平板电脑)的应用程序。APP制作开发方法包括以下几个步骤:需求分析、UI设计、前端开发、后端开发和测试发布。下面将对每个步骤进行具体介绍。1.
2023-07-14
app开发苹果端需要多少钱
App开发苹果端的费用是一个相对复杂的问题,它受到多个因素的影响。在这篇文章中,我将详细介绍开发苹果端App的原理和相关费用。首先,让我们来了解一下App开发的基本原理。苹果端App开发主要基于iOS操作系统,开发者使用苹果官方提供的开发工具和语言进行开发
2023-06-29
app开发基础入门
App开发是近年来非常热门的领域,无论是企业还是个人都希望通过App来扩展业务或者创造新的商机。但是对于很多初学者来说,App开发可能是一个比较困难和陌生的领域,特别是一些没有编程基础的人员。本文将介绍App开发的基础入门知识,并解析App开发的原理。一、
2023-06-29